Prior to House MD. Scrubs launched 2001 and House in 2004. House MD is arguably the most accurate medical show to exist, mainly because the majority of wacky medical mysteries came from actual doctors. It is still TV of course, but real stories can't be beat by Hollywood make believe.
The cases may be real, however medicine is never done like in House.
The application of cutting corners, but the actual science and interplay of symptoms is accurate.
That's what they are saying. Sure House is scientifically accurate as far as the symptoms and diseases.
Scrubs is far more accurate, because that's what practicing medicine in a hospital can be like, and they show how medicine is actually practiced, as opposed to House's "Superdoc" approach.
That's just turning the argument into "Do you want realistic medical science" or "realistic day to day operations of a hospital".
I'm not going to argue over surveys and personal opinion. I'm in it for the science of disease, not how a hospital functions.
